One of my favorite fall vegetables to decorate with is the pumpkin. Pumpkins make wonderful serving bowls if you hollow them out. You can have them do double duty, for function and decoration.
Or use a pumpkin as the base for a floral arrangement.

Fruit and floral combinations work wonderful for party, or wedding table centerpieces. They make a nice contrast in texture and color.
Citrus is my favorite to work with in floral arrangements. I love their bright vivid colors, and they will hold up for several days without spoiling.

You don’t have to incorporate the fruit in the arrangement, you can hollow out an orange, or an apple and use them for as a vase for your floral centerpiece.

Arrange flowers and fruit in a basket to give your backyard party a casual feel.

July is hot dog month, and July 23rd is National Hot Dog Day. That sounds like a great reason to fire up the grill, and invite a few friends over to celebrate. Make sure you have all the extras for the hot dogs.

Set up a fully loaded hot dog bar with buns, chili sauce, sauerkraut, mustard, ketchup, cheese, onion, relish, tomato, and anything else you can think of that people might want to add to their hot dog.

I love chocolate covered anything, but chocolate covered strawberries make a fabulous party appetizer, or simple dessert, especially this time of year.

You can coat the strawberries with chocolate ahead of time, and drizzle on several different types of chocolate from white to dark for an elegant look, and exotic taste. Or you can make a chocolate fondue and let your guests make their own chocolate covered strawberries.
